Hobs Induction
Induction hobs are a favorite choice for those who prefer a sleek, efficient way to cook. They make use of electromagnetic induction to warm pans. Beneath the glass surface sit coils that, when a compatible pan is placed on the top emit a magnetic field which creates an electrical current that flow through the bottom of the pan. This produces heat that quickly warms food inside the cooktop while it remains cool to the touch.
Induction hobs are also known as being more energy efficient than traditional models, regardless of whether they are gas or electric. As they only produce heat directly where the pan is placed this helps reduce the amount of residual heat that is wasted and can also help reduce energy costs. Induction hobs are often equipped with a safety function that will shut off the appliance in the event that no pan is detected or if the pan is removed, further minimizing the amount of waste.
Similar to gas hobs, induction models come with a variety of control options that include dial, slide and touchscreen controls. A slider control is similar to a standard cooker knob and allows you to adjust the power level with just one movement. Dial controls are similar to a standard knob and come with a large dial that can be rotated to select the desired setting. Touchscreen hobs, which are typically found on more expensive induction models with advanced features, are another option. They feature an enlightened digital display that makes it easy to read and alter settings.
In addition to the tech, induction hobs can be fitted with built-in extractors that work in conjunction with the hood to draw smoke and steam from the kitchen, and also prevent condensation and mould. These can be operated independently from the other hobs and are usually activated by a sensor or button. They can also be programmed to automatically switch on once an oven and hob is placed over a cooking zone.
The biggest drawback of induction hobs is that they require a special type of cookware to operate. The bottom of the pan has to have a magnetic base to be able to generate the electromagnetic induction process, and even then it isn't guaranteed to work with all models. Cast iron, stainless steel with magnetized bases, and certain nonstick pans may be used with induction cooktops. However, you must always consult the manufacturer to ensure that the pan you are using is compatible before buying a model.
